Blitzy Promotes Prompt Engineering Session to Showcase Enterprise AI Tooling

According to a recent LinkedIn post from Blitzy, the company is promoting a free live session focused on practical prompt engineering techniques for large language models. The event, scheduled for March 10, will be led by AI solutions specialists and aims to teach core principles that remain useful despite frequent model updates.

The post emphasizes that prompt engineering remains highly variable across models, citing an arXiv study indicating response quality can shift significantly depending on phrasing. Blitzy also highlights its own platform as an abstraction layer intended to manage differences between models and streamline prompt design for enterprise users.

Content outlined for the session includes guidance on durable prompting methods, key elements of effective enterprise prompts, and a live walkthrough of Blitzy’s prompting interface. A live Q&A component is also planned, suggesting the company is seeking direct engagement with potential or existing users interested in optimizing AI workflows.

For investors, the post suggests that Blitzy is positioning itself as an infrastructure and tooling provider sitting on top of multiple LLMs rather than betting on a single model. This approach could support recurring, usage-based revenue if enterprises adopt the platform to standardize AI interactions and reduce dependence on internal prompt engineering expertise.

By framing prompt engineering as a complex and evolving challenge, the session appears to function as both education and product demonstration. If the event successfully converts attendees into paying customers or upsells existing users, it could help deepen customer relationships and improve Blitzy’s competitive position in the enterprise AI tooling segment.
